4-Software: The combination of EPMS, DCIM, and BMS allows for real-time monitoring, enhanced visibility, and control of critical infrastructure, leading to improved efficiencies, reduced downtime, and lower operational costs. Key benefits of integrating these systems include faster modernization, increased financial gains, streamlined processes, standardized system designs, and enhanced security.
In the AI era, infrastructure is everything. Organizations that fail to evolve their data centers for high-density workloads will face rising costs, slower innovation, and shrinking competitive ground. Success won’ t come to those who simply build bigger, but to those who build smarter.
NTT Global Data Centers Partners with Schneider Electric to Streamline Data Center Software
NTT Global Data Centers division is the world’ s third largest data center provider, operating over 160 data centers in more than 20 countries. The company offers full-stack services, and is one of the largest connected platforms globally.
Due to the company’ s fast growth trajectory, NTT faced multiple challenges stemming from fragmentation among its locations. Processes were handled differently across regions and teams, including sales, construction and operations, and its data center designs weren’ t uniform.
To streamline operations, NTT teamed up with Schneider Electric to provide a standardized software solution for its North American data centers. Schneider Electric’ s solution was two-fold: it provided a Building Management System( BMS) and integrated Energy and Power Monitoring System( EPMS) solution, including controls and monitoring for NTT’ s power and cooling infrastructure, as well as cybersecurity software.
BMS is a centralized platform that monitors, controls, and optimizes a building’ s core infrastructure, including HVAC, lighting, energy, fire safety, and security systems. EPMS provides power management features including real-time monitoring and power quality, as well as energy management such as energy visualization dashboards and reports. This Schneider Electric software gives NTT and its tenants critical, real-time visibility of their missioncritical systems, and helps ensure the sites remain reliable, efficient, and operational.
The cybersecurity solution helps NTT to reduce enterprise-wide digital risk, avoid costs related to downtime, while helping to enforce global security standards that make NTT’ s operational environments more secure and resilient for its tenants. The platform inventories and monitors every piece of connected operational technology, helping detect cybersecurity threats, risks, and vulnerabilities. This was a critical requirement for NTT, especially for its legacy sites – helping to mitigate potential risks and positioning it to serve key clients, including government entities.
This strategic alliance between Schneider Electric and NTT continues to grow as Schneider Electric begins to deliver its standardized BMS / EPMS and cybersecurity solutions beyond NTT’ s North American facilities, deploying them across its data center portfolio globally.
